Gannon Women's Water Polo Team Among Others Receiving Votes in Latest CWPA Top 10 Poll

The Gannon women's water polo team has been among the CWPA's best all season long.
ERIE, Pa. - The Gannon women's water polo team is among others receiving votes for the ninth time in the last 10 weeks in the latest Collegiate Water Polo Association (CWPA) Top 10 poll released Thursday afternoon.

The University of Michigan is still the unanimous No. 1 team for the 14th straight week, receiving 100 points. Hartwick College (94), Indiana University (91) and Bucknell University (83) completed the top four. Princeton University (78) and Brown University (78) were tied for fifth.

The University of Maryland (70), Harvard University (66), George Washington (59) and Mercyhurst College (45) rounded out the top 10. Gannon was the only team listed among others receiving votes with 11 points.

Head coach Don Sherman's squad concluded the 2010 season with a 9-21 record. The Lady Knights finished fourth at the CWPA Western Division Championships.

Senior Annie Greenhill (Brea, Calif./Brea Olinda) was Gannon's leading scorer with 49 goals, 25 assists and 40 steals. Sophomores Colleen Harriger (Erie, Pa./McDowell) and Molly Andrews (Tustin, Calif./Tustin) were second and third with 46 and 34 goals, respectively.

Freshman Janelle Bartman (Buffalo Grove, Ill./Stevenson) started 27 of 30 matches in goal, producing an 8.26 goals against average and .424 save percentage.
